1. Flaxseeds – Rich in Lignans and Omega-3s

Flaxseeds are an excellent source of lignans and omega-3 fatty acids, compounds that research strongly links to powerful anti-inflammatory effects. These properties may assist in balancing hormones and easing joint discomfort, which is a common complaint in later years. Epidemiological studies further suggest that a higher intake of flaxseeds could be associated with lower risks for certain cancers, including breast and prostate cancer.

2. Chia Seeds – Packed with Antioxidants and Fiber

Chia seeds deliver a substantial amount of ALA omega-3s and a diverse range of antioxidants. Laboratory studies have indicated their potential to shield cells from damage and help maintain stable energy levels throughout the day. Their high fiber content is also beneficial for digestive health, addressing a frequent concern among seniors that significantly impacts overall comfort and well-being.

3. Pumpkin Seeds – Source of Zinc and Magnesium

Pumpkin seeds provide vital nutrients like zinc, crucial for robust immune system support, and magnesium, essential for muscle relaxation and nerve function. These minerals may collectively help combat fatigue and sustain healthy activity levels. Animal research has also hinted at their protective roles against oxidative stress, reinforcing their value for cellular health.

4. Sesame Seeds – Containing Sesamin and Antioxidants

Sesame seeds are notable for their sesamin content, a lignan extensively studied in laboratory settings for its anti-inflammatory and cell-protective properties. These attributes may contribute to improved liver health and support detoxification processes, which can naturally slow down with age.

5. Sunflower Seeds – High in Vitamin E and Selenium

Sunflower seeds are abundant in vitamin E and selenium, two powerful antioxidants that studies have consistently linked to reduced inflammation and enhanced cellular protection. Regular consumption may help preserve skin radiance and overall vitality, contributing to a more youthful appearance.

6. Black Seeds (Nigella Sativa) – With Thymoquinone

Black seeds, also known as Nigella Sativa, contain thymoquinone, a bioactive compound that has been extensively researched for its profound anti-inflammatory effects and potential to support immune system regulation. This offers significant promise for alleviating joint discomfort and enhancing overall bodily resilience.

📊 Quick Comparison of Key Nutrients

This concise table offers a clear overview of the primary nutrients found in these beneficial seeds and their potential areas of support:

Seed Key Compounds Potential Support Area Research Notes
Flaxseeds Lignans, Omega-3s Hormone balance, inflammation Epidemiologic links to lower risks
Chia Seeds ALA, Antioxidants Cell protection, blood sugar Lab evidence of antioxidant effects
Pumpkin Seeds Zinc, Magnesium Immune, muscle health Supports oxidative defense
Sesame Seeds Sesamin, Antioxidants Detoxification, anti-inflammatory Preclinical anti-cancer activity
Sunflower Seeds Vitamin E, Selenium Antioxidant protection Tied to reduced inflammation
Black Seeds Thymoquinone Immune regulation Extensive studies on mechanisms

✅ Easy Ways to Add These Seeds Daily

Incorporating these nutrient-rich seeds into your daily meals is surprisingly simple and can significantly enhance your nutritional intake without requiring drastic dietary changes. Consider sprinkling them over your morning yogurt or oatmeal, blending them into smoothies, adding them to salads for extra crunch, or even incorporating them into baked goods like bread and muffins. A consistent, varied intake of these seeds is a practical and effective step towards bolstering your body’s natural defenses and promoting long-term cellular health.
